Creating drawer families

You can create a drawer family to group two or more drawers that are related in some way. Examples of drawers that you might assign to families include related corporations (controlled groups or consolidated clients), and clients who are related, such as parents and their children.
One drawer can have one or more drawer family associations. When a drawer is a member of one or more families, a family name folder you specified appears in the Drawer list for each member drawer. You can expand a Family folder to show the icons of the other drawers in the family. Select these icons to quickly switch between member drawers.
  1. In the
    Folders
    window, select a drawer that you want to include in the new family.
  2. Choose
    File
    Drawer Properties
    .
  3. Select the
    Select Family
    button.
  4. Select the
    Add
    button and enter a family name in the
    Family Name
    field.
  5. Highlight a drawer that you want to include in this family in the
    Drawers available to assign
    pane and use the
    Select
    button to add it to the
    Drawers to assign
    pane. Repeat this step for each drawer that you want to include in this family.
    note
    The current drawer will be automatically selected in the
    Drawers to assign
    pane.
  6. Select
    Enter
    or
    OK
    .
note
  • If a drawer is a member of a family, all other family members will appear in the
    Print
    and
    Send To > Email Recipient
    and
    File Location
    dialogs so that you can print and send documents from multiple drawers at one time.
  • A family must contain two or more drawers.
  • For UltraTax CS users, drawer families are automatically created in some cases.
  • A drawer can be a member of one or more families.
  • A family cannot include drawers from multiple data locations.
  • Mark the status checkboxes to list drawers with selected statuses only.
  • Drawer families created prior to the release of 2009 FileCabinet CS will have a Family Name description of
    <Unnamed Family>
    listed in the
    Family name
    column of the
    Selected Drawer Families
    dialog. If you choose to edit the
    <Unnamed Family>
    , the
    Family Name
    text will default to
    Family
    unless otherwise specified. Select the
    Enter
    or
    OK
    button to save the new family name.
  • Duplicate family names can be created for a single drawer, but this method is not recommended.
  • If you add drawers from another family to a new family, the other members of the existing family are not added to the new family.
